Pole building siding services involve the installation, repair, or replacement of exterior siding on pole barns, garages, and other similar structures. This service ensures that the building’s outer surface is properly sealed and protected from the elements, helping to maintain its structural integrity and appearance. Contractors specializing in pole building siding can work with a variety of materials, including metal, wood, or vinyl, to match the existing look or upgrade the structure’s durability. Proper siding installation not only enhances the building’s visual appeal but also provides a barrier against moisture, pests, and weather-related wear and tear.
This service is particularly useful for addressing common issues such as damaged or warped siding, rusted panels, or areas where the siding has become loose or detached. Over time, exposure to rain, snow, and wind can cause siding to deteriorate, leading to leaks, drafts, or even structural damage if left unaddressed. Siding repair and replacement services help homeowners restore their building’s protective layer, preventing further problems and extending the lifespan of the structure. These services are also valuable when upgrading older siding to newer, more resilient materials that require less maintenance.

The overview below groups typical Pole Building Siding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Edison,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or siding repairs on pole buildings in the Edison area range from $250-$600. Many routine fixes, such as patching or replacing small sections, fall within this range. Fewer projects reach into higher cost brackets unless additional work is needed.
Moderate Projects - Mid-sized siding replacements or upgrades us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ects often involve replacing larger sections or updating the appearance, which local contractors handle regularly within this budget.
Full Siding Replacement - Complete siding overhauls on pole buildings tend to range from $3,500 to $8,000. Larger, more complex projects, including extensive surface prep and custom materials, can reach higher costs but are less common.
Custom or Complex Installations - Highly detailed or custom siding jobs, such as specialty materials or intricate designs, can exceed $8,000 and may go beyond $10,000. These projects are typically less frequent and involve specialized service providers in the Edison area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of siding are available for pole buildings? Local contractors often offer a variety of siding options such as metal, vinyl, wood, and fiber cement to suit different aesthetic and durability needs.
Can pole building siding be customized to match existing structures? Yes, many service providers can customize siding colors and styles to coordinate with existing buildings or personal preferences.
What are the benefits of updating pole building siding? Updating siding can enhance curb appeal, improve weather resistance, and increase the overall value of the property.
Are there maintenance considerations for pole building siding? Maintenance requirements vary by siding type, with some options needing regular cleaning or painting to maintain appearance and durability.
How do local contractors handle siding installation on pole buildings? Experienced service providers typically assess the structure, prepare the surface, and install siding carefully to ensure a secure and long-lasting finish.
